Because the world is shifting its perspective on security and favouring biometric security over conventional passwords, the protection of biometric data is one of the most crucial security goals of the modern day. The emphasis is placed heavily on the use of arithmetic encoding for the compression of embedding data, and it is crucial to use a variety of biometrics rather than relying solely on one. It is suggested to transmit biometric data securely using block-by-block reversible encryption. Block wise encryption provides a high embedding space for the compressed biometric data as compared to other methods. The lossless arithmetic encoding approach not only allows for total reversibility but also precise secret data extraction and lossless image restoration. A substantial amount of data gathered through various comparisons can be used to support the notion that data compression and biometric data embedding rates can be significantly raised and can indicate successful working. Biometric data is encrypted to prevent unauthorised parties from accessing it, and the embedding of additional data is made possible by the lossless compression process of arithmetic encoding. The biometric data may be hidden in an image and stored in a database that is only accessible with a key that may be used to decode and extract the data without compromising the image's low efficacy or causing any data loss.
